Mobile Service started for victim’s ease

  The District Police Office of Chitwan has started a new mobile service in Women and Children Service Center to hear an immediate complaint related to women and children. Government’s Process to make Shelter is Hectic: Earthquake victims

The earthquake victims of Betali VDC have complained of government’s process being hectic to make shelter. The victims complained about the hectic bureaucratic process that needed to be followed while making shelter.
